Go to the store and get rubbing alcohol and sea salt. Pour some of each into your piece, shake, dump, and rinse. Repeat as needed. It will get all the resin out.

i've boiled many peices many times over and they've NEVER EVER EVER come out like new this way. resin doesnt mix with water at all, and water doesnt get resin off the pipes. the heat from the boiling softens it, and the violent activity of boiling helps further get some of the resin off, but a good bit of it invariable seems to remain inside the pipe. getting it "like new" will require soaking it in some kind of solvent (like a strong alcohol solution) for a few hours at least. usually i let peices soak overnight.
